Ben Bangert
37fc280300
fix(event-broker): exit with non-zero for unhandledRejection
...
Closes #1803
2019-07-24 14:12:52 -07:00
Ben Bangert
141c9cc945
fix(support-panel): add gitignore for dist/common files
...
Closes #1869
2019-07-24 13:53:48 -07:00
Les Orchard
3c786be962
Merge pull request #1926 from lmorchard/subscription-redirect-path-tweak
...
fix(payments): Do not require trailing slash for /subscriptions redirect on content-server
2019-07-24 13:47:02 -07:00
Vlad Filippov
5cef1a2f6c
Merge pull request #1925 from annygakh/patch-1
...
fix(typo): fixed typo in scrypt.js
2019-07-24 16:10:34 -04:00
Les Orchard
4440abb516
fix(payments): Do not require trailing slash for /subscriptions redirect on content-server
2019-07-24 13:04:17 -07:00
Anny
ffdfe93833
fix(typo): fixed typo in scrypt.js
2019-07-24 15:33:13 -04:00
John Morrison
02fe9a1e5a
Merge pull request #1924 from mozilla/123done-configure-fxa-stage-paymentURL
...
fix(123done): configure stage paymentURL
2019-07-24 11:44:48 -07:00
Les Orchard
ddce01ffef
Merge pull request #1899 from lmorchard/1850-subscription-management-links
...
feat(payments): support /subscriptions redirect on content-server
2019-07-24 11:27:09 -07:00
John Morrison
098372c8e5
fix(123done): configure stage paymentURL
2019-07-24 11:11:30 -07:00
Dave Justice
5083c7bd75
Merge pull request #1912 from meandavejustice/1858-zip-code-field-tweak
...
Zip code field tweak and add name field placeholder
2019-07-24 12:00:00 -04:00
Phil Booth
434ed7258c
Merge pull request #1920 from mozilla/pb/api-docs-warning
...
https://github.com/mozilla/fxa/pull/1920
r=bbangert
2019-07-24 15:53:25 +00:00
Phil Booth
393e59445e
chore(docs): add note warning that api docs are wrong
2019-07-24 16:17:25 +01:00
Shane Tomlinson
345a6649c2
Release 1.141.8
2019-07-24 15:59:10 +01:00
Shane Tomlinson
695c8c808a
Merge pull request #1900 from mozilla/firetv-oldsync-scope-validation r=@shane-tomlinson
...
chore(config): Add FireTV to the validation list for "oldsync" scope.
2019-07-24 15:58:41 +01:00
Shane Tomlinson
21be4453d3
Merge pull request #1841 from mozilla/i1814-oauth-resource-indicator-draft-spec r=@rfk
...
feat(oauth): Support the `resource` parameter when fetching JWT access tokens.
2019-07-24 15:57:07 +01:00
Barry Chen
8c92e0a7af
Merge pull request #1916 from chenba/1078-sub-mgmt-button
...
feat(subscriptions): show subscriptions management Settings subpanel …
2019-07-24 09:50:40 -05:00
Barry Chen
ce776d3e41
feat(subscriptions): show subscriptions management Settings subpanel only when there are active subscriptions
...
This patch also removes everything related to language check for
subscriptions management. See https://github.com/mozilla/fxa/issues/1078#issuecomment-509296642
Fixes #1078
2019-07-24 09:17:14 -05:00
Ryan Kelly
6fcb1c9f26
chore(config): Add FireTV to the validation list for "oldsync" scope.
...
Ref https://bugzilla.mozilla.org/show_bug.cgi?id=1566346
2019-07-24 17:41:22 +10:00
Shane Tomlinson
b64b3c6a48
fix(l10n): Only support the `bn` locale, `bn-BD` will be removed.
...
fixes #1840
2019-07-24 17:41:22 +10:00
Shane Tomlinson
a4cf89ae5c
fix(fxa-shared): Use fxa-shared@1.0.27 in the content/auth servers.
...
v1.0.27 is already pushed to npm from using the `np` command,
this updates all the package.json and lockfiles.
2019-07-24 17:41:22 +10:00
Phil Booth
3d132d59be
chore(ci): ignore RUSTSEC-2019-0011
2019-07-24 11:26:33 +10:00
dave justice
537fa3f4a6
fix(payments): add placeholder for card name field
2019-07-23 21:19:30 -04:00
Ben Bangert
ef391d8a6f
Merge pull request #1855 from mozilla/fix/long-build-times
...
feat: reduce build time for fxa-email-service
2019-07-23 17:57:03 -07:00
Ben Bangert
45b304acb3
feat: reduce build time for fxa-email-service
2019-07-23 17:27:49 -07:00
Jared Hirsch
7b8ff9fe63
schedule renovate to just run on weekends
2019-07-23 16:44:25 -07:00
Les Orchard
2e2b90a720
feat(payments): support /subscriptions redirect on content-server
...
fixes #1850
2019-07-23 15:39:43 -07:00
Jared Hirsch
671c5cb0eb
Try removing the ignorePaths, see if the includePaths are enough
2019-07-23 13:48:42 -07:00
dave justice
1fe6a910f2
fix(payments): zip code field style tweaks
...
- fixes #1858
2019-07-23 16:03:29 -04:00
Dave Justice
467688420b
Merge pull request #1911 from meandavejustice/1859-remove-value-prop-copy
...
fix(payments): update value copy on payment form
2019-07-23 15:55:13 -04:00
dave justice
27f5c314c4
fix(payments): update value copy on payment form
...
- fixes #1859
2019-07-23 15:08:31 -04:00
Les Orchard
1a437eb776
Merge pull request #1879 from 6a68/1694-extend-payments-session
...
feat(payments): extend payment server session from 15 min to 30 min
2019-07-23 11:01:26 -07:00
Jared Hirsch
8ad0e23e54
Update renovate.json
2019-07-23 10:33:53 -07:00
Jared Hirsch
3a72936993
Try to only ignore top-level package.json
2019-07-23 10:13:54 -07:00
Jared Hirsch
69e8c438db
See if package.json is getting skipped
2019-07-23 10:10:38 -07:00
Jared Hirsch
90398abaa1
Fix syntax error
2019-07-23 10:09:13 -07:00
Jared Hirsch
02280b1630
Update renovate.json
...
Ignore the monorepo top-level config and package files
2019-07-23 10:08:23 -07:00
Jared Hirsch
151e25f08f
Update renovate config
...
Try a single includePath instead of many ignorePaths
2019-07-23 10:05:54 -07:00
Jared Hirsch
753190b837
Update renovate config
...
From top to bottom in the renovate.json file:
* Limit renovate to 2 open PRs at a time
* Do not allow renovate to auto-merge changes
* Prefix renovate PRs with "renovate/"
* Attempt to limit renovate to just the payments-server by ignoring other packages
2019-07-23 09:58:03 -07:00
Renovate Bot
3dc17a180a
chore(deps): add renovate.json
2019-07-23 16:35:14 +00:00
Jared Hirsch
e4d7a90208
feat(payments): extend payment server session from 15 min to 30 min
...
Fixes #1694
2019-07-23 09:02:10 -07:00
Dave Justice
2aba7866d7
Merge pull request #1896 from 6a68/1128-audit-deps
...
chore(payments): add npm auditing to payments-server dependencies
2019-07-23 10:12:43 -04:00
Phil Booth
4abac1fd19
Merge train-142 into master
...
https://github.com/mozilla/fxa/pull/1906
r=vladikoff
2019-07-23 14:11:35 +00:00
Phil Booth
760a0e4203
Release 1.142.0
2019-07-23 14:11:18 +01:00
Phil Booth
948453faaa
chore(build): add fxa-support-panel to the release script
2019-07-23 14:11:04 +01:00
Phil Booth
87f15e2790
fix(package): bump email service version strings to 141.7
2019-07-23 14:09:58 +01:00
Shane Tomlinson
a5b73cfcd5
Merge pull request #1904 from mozilla/i1854-ppid-seed-test r=@philbooth
...
fix(ppid): Fix the failing ppid test.
2019-07-23 12:55:09 +01:00
Shane Tomlinson
b4f7cfc15a
fix(ppid): Fix the failing ppid test.
...
The failing test checked that two `sub`s in two JWT access
tokens were the same as long as they had the same ppid_seed,
and did not take into account the server may have force
rotated the sub. This would be especially problematic
on CI VMs which are slow and where tests take longer.
The "fix" is to no longer compare the `sub` claims
between the two tokens.
fixes #1854
2019-07-23 12:10:41 +01:00
Ryan Kelly
3bae976ca7
Merge pull request #1865 from mozilla/i1837-fix-flaky-test; r=philbooth
...
Fix flaky OAuth test
2019-07-23 12:19:02 +10:00
Ryan Kelly
48a8894b8a
chore(tests): Fix flaky OAuth test by enforcing a consistent ordering
2019-07-23 10:13:25 +10:00
Ben Bangert
bc93260b59
Merge pull request #1898 from mozilla/restore-keypair-dep
...
chore(deps): Restore `keypair` dependency
2019-07-22 17:04:27 -07:00